What Makes the Brass Valve Construction & 125 PSI Pressure Rating Superior for Water Heater Protection?
The Taco LB-075-H-2LF features investment-cast brass body construction with 3/4-inch female NPT threading at both inlet and outlet ports, eliminating sweat connection requirements common in alternative hot water tank installation procedures. The valve body measures 4-7/8 inches in overall length with a 4-3/8 inch height dimension, creating compact installation profiles in confined mechanical spaces typical of hot water cylinder installations in residential basements and utility closets.
Internal valve components include PTFE seat material rated for continuous exposure to 135°F potable water service, with FKM elastomer seals providing chemical resistance across water heaters electric and gas configurations. The full-port ball design maintains the complete 3/4-inch internal diameter throughout the flow path, achieving the 32 Cv rating essential for supporting simultaneous hot water demands from tank water heaters serving multiple fixtures during peak usage periods.
This MPN LB-075-H-2LF valve operates at a maximum working pressure of 140 PSI with a shut-off pressure rating of 125 PSI, accommodating variable municipal water pressure conditions while maintaining reliable closure under full line pressure. The brass alloy composition meets NSF/ANSI 61 standards for potable water contact, ensuring suitability for installation on cold water supply lines feeding Energy Star certified heat pump water heater models and conventional storage tank configurations.
Static pressure tolerance extends to 300 PSI, providing safety margin against water hammer events occurring during rapid valve closure or when thermostatic mixing valves modulate flow rates downstream of the hot water tank. The valve's engineered polymer trim components resist dezincification and galvanic corrosion when installed in mixed-metal plumbing systems combining copper supply piping with steel tank water heater nipple connections.

How Does the Integrated Motorized Actuator Assembly with Quick-Disconnect Mounting Function?
The LB-075-H-2LF's direct-mount actuator assembly employs an engineered polymer housing measuring 3-3/16 inches high by 1-5/8 inches wide by 4 inches deep, containing the motorized mechanism driving 90-degree ball rotation from open to closed positions. Unlike pneumatic actuators requiring compressed air supply systems, this electric actuator draws 70mA at 120VAC during valve movement, returning to minimal standby current consumption after achieving full closure against incoming water pressure.
The quick-connect mounting interface allows tool-free actuator removal from the valve body without disrupting threaded NPT connections in the water heating system piping, facilitating field testing and maintenance procedures. This removable design feature proves essential during hot water tank replacement projects where plumbers verify LeakBreaker functionality before completing new tank water heater installations or upgrading to heat pump configurations.
Actuator operation completes the full 90-degree valve closure cycle in approximately 10 seconds following sensor activation, providing rapid response essential for containing hot water tank leaking events before significant water volume escapes. The motorized mechanism incorporates internal limit switches confirming full-open and full-closed positions, enabling the integrated control module to verify successful valve closure and maintain closed status until manual reset procedures restore water supply to the tank water heater.
The engineered polymer actuator housing resists moisture exposure and temperature fluctuations in mechanical room environments, maintaining operational reliability in installations serving hot water tanks in unconditioned basement spaces or exterior utility closets. Direct mounting eliminates the external bracket assemblies and coupling hardware typical of retrofit actuator installations, reducing the vertical profile critical in installations beneath low-clearance floor joists or tight spacing above heat pump water heater units.

What Features Does the Dual-Power Control Module with LED Status & Battery Backup Provide?
The Taco LB-075-H-2LF includes a wall-mountable control module housing the electronic circuitry governing sensor monitoring, valve actuation, and alarm functions essential for unattended water heater protection. This control panel operates on 120VAC primary power with integrated battery backup accepting four AA batteries, ensuring protection continuity during electrical outages affecting homes with electric hot water tanks reliant on grid power for heating elements.
The module's two-color LED indicator provides continuous visual status feedback, displaying green illumination during normal monitoring mode and switching to red when the floor sensor detects moisture or when battery voltage drops below operational thresholds. This visible status confirmation allows homeowners to verify LeakBreaker system integrity during routine inspections without initiating test sequences that temporarily interrupt water supply to the hot water tank.
An integrated audible alarm produces loud alerting signals upon sensor activation, notifying occupants of hot water tank leaking conditions even when mechanical rooms are located in remote basement areas distant from living spaces. The alarm circuit includes a mute function allowing temporary silence during cleanup and repair procedures following hot water cylinder failures, while maintaining valve closure and LED warning indicators until proper reset sequences restore normal operation.
Quick-connect wiring terminals simplify electrical connections between the control module, sensor pad, and valve actuator assembly, eliminating the complexity of hardwired installations common in alternative water heater protection systems. The modular wiring design supports field troubleshooting by allowing technicians to isolate individual components when diagnosing system performance during routine maintenance or after extended service periods exceeding manufacturer warranty intervals.
The control module incorporates two sets of dry contact relay outputs rated for integration with whole-house security systems or building automation platforms managing multiple water heating installations in multi-family residential properties. These normally-open/normally-closed contacts enable remote monitoring capabilities essential for landlords managing rental properties with tank water heaters in occupied units where immediate leak notification prevents extensive property damage and associated hot water tank replacement costs.

How Does Advanced Floor Sensor Technology with Precision Moisture Detection Prevent Water Damage?
The LB-075-H-2LF package includes a low-profile floor sensor pad employing solid-state moisture detection technology eliminating the corrosion-prone metal terminals found in competitive water heater protection devices. This sensor design maintains reliable operation throughout extended service intervals, avoiding the performance degradation affecting systems with exposed electrical contacts subjected to dust accumulation and humidity exposure in basement mechanical rooms.
Sensor placement flexibility accommodates installation directly on concrete floors beneath tank water heaters or inside drain pans collecting discharge from temperature-pressure relief valves during normal thermal expansion events. The sensor cable extends to standard lengths supporting positioning several feet from wall-mounted control modules, accommodating the varied spatial arrangements encountered in hot water tank installation configurations ranging from compact closet installations to spacious mechanical room deployments.
Detection sensitivity triggers valve closure upon contact with minimal water quantities, providing early intervention before hot water tank leaking progresses from minor seepage to catastrophic rupture releasing the complete 40-80 gallon capacity typical of residential storage tanks. This rapid-response capability prevents the extensive water damage associated with overnight or vacation-period failures when delayed discovery allows sustained water release affecting finished basement spaces, adjacent rooms, and structural components beneath hot water cylinder installations.
The sensor's testable design allows homeowners and service technicians to verify system responsiveness without creating actual leak conditions, supporting the quarterly inspection schedules recommended for maintaining optimal protection of tank water heaters approaching their 10-15 year service life expectancy. Testing procedures involve applying moisture directly to sensor surfaces while observing valve closure timing and alarm activation, confirming all LeakBreaker components function correctly before actual emergency conditions arise.
